Output 61fed3d34279536920e90a8617d14e2392a89149f84a97aa15c6923c5d3fc0cb:7

value
51899
script pubkey
OP_0 OP_PUSHBYTES_20 fc565488d0e71d38502585dcd664d3e7d98605dd
address
bc1ql3t9fzxsuuwns5p9shwdvexnulvcvpwa5687km
transaction
61fed3d34279536920e90a8617d14e2392a89149f84a97aa15c6923c5d3fc0cb
spent
true